Challenges in the Sector
The recent updates in terms of climate change mitigation and adaptation, Ethiopia Launches National Determined Contribution (NDC) Implementation Plan in July 2024 to Enhance Climate-Resilient Green Economy. In last year with the Ministry of Planning and Development (MoPD) leadership, assessment was conducted on CRGE implementation gaps and challenges since 2011 and there is a need to revitalize the Integrated Climate Governance.
The assessment identified the following key gaps and challenges on the CRGE implementation:
- Lack of Adequate Planning, Mainstreaming and Implementation Capacities.
- Lack of MRV Protocols and Weak Emission Tracking Capacities.
- Lack of Coherent, Consistent and Comprehensive Climate Change Indicators and Weak Knowledge Management and Communication Systems.
- Weak Intra and Inter-Sectoral Coordination.
- Limited Access to International Climate Finance and Climate Smart Technologies.
- Limited Engagement of Private Sector in The Implementation of CRGE Initiatives and
- Weak Coordination of Non-Government Actors Implementing Climate Change Related Programs and Activities in Ethiopia.
In this regard, to strengthen CRGE implementation, the Ministry of Planning and Development (MoPD) has revitalizes for integrated Climate Governance, which will re-strengthen a unified CRGE Ministerial Committee, chaired and co-chaired by MoPD and Ministry of Finance (MoF); all the technical work specific to CRGE sectors will be integrated and conducted at each relevant government bodies; and the CRGE Development Partners Forum designed to strengthen the role and participation of the development partners in their climate actions and investment in Ethiopia.
